What’s Galati Like in September?

September in Galati, Romania, marks a pleasant transition from summer to autumn. The weather is generally mild, and crowds are typically moderate to low as the peak tourist season subsides. This month offers a good balance of comfortable temperatures and fewer visitors, ideal for exploring the city.

What is the Weather and Climate in Galati in September?

September in Galati typically brings mild to warm days, gradually cooling through the month.

What are Typical Costs and Availability in Galati in September?

Galati is an affordable destination, and September, being a shoulder season, often presents good value.

What to Expect Regarding Crowds, Events, and Conditions in Galati in September?

September in Galati sees fewer crowds than peak summer. Expect a relaxed atmosphere. While no large international festivals are typical, local cultural events or harvest celebrations might occur; check local listings. Conditions are generally favorable for sightseeing, with pleasant weather.
